Coffee is known for its exfoliating and antioxidant properties, while eggs, particularly egg whites, are celebrated for their ability to tighten and tone the skin. Together, these ingredients create a powerhouse mask that can help rejuvenate your skin, leaving it smooth, radiant, and refreshed.
Dr Arushi Suri, Consultant Dermatologist & Aesthetic Medicine, Mahatma Gandhi Hospital, Jaipur, explained that a mask made of coffee and egg whites has been used for tightening the skin reducing puffiness and brightening the complexion due to the antioxidant properties of caffeine and proteins.
However, she believes that it can do more harm than good, especially for people with sensitive or acne-prone skin. There is a risk of a mild to severe allergic reaction to both the ingredients esp eggs along with a risk of salmonella infection which may be present in raw eggs if consumed by mistake or applied on wounds or breaks in the skin from where bacteria could enter. It could also lead to a massive acne flare-up.
Before a person applies egg whites to their face, they should do a patch test and ensure that there is no redness, itching, swelling, or other signs of an allergic reaction. The expert further suggests choosing safer alternatives or consulting a dermatologist for science-backed solutions.

Benefits of Coffee in Skincare
When not mixed with egg, coffee does provide certain benefits to the skin and some of them are mentioned below.
- Exfoliation: Coffee grounds serve as a natural exfoliant, effectively scrubbing away dead skin cells.
- Anti-inflammatory Properties: Coffee is rich in antioxidants, particularly chlorogenic acid, which has been shown to reduce inflammation and calm irritated skin.
- Brightening Effects: The caffeine in coffee can help improve blood circulation when applied topically, potentially leading to a brighter complexion.
- Antioxidant Protection: Coffee contains a variety of antioxidants that combat oxidative stress, which can lead to premature ageing signs such as fine lines and wrinkles.
Benefits of Egg in Skincare
On the other hand, eggs do contain elements that are beneficial for skincare when used alone.
- Skin Tightening: Egg whites are known for their skin-tightening properties due to their high protein content.
- Oil Control: Egg whites can absorb excess oil from the skin, making them particularly useful for those with oily or combination skin types.
- Pore Minimisation: Using egg whites in a mask may help reduce the appearance of pores, contributing to a more refined skin texture.
- Nutritional Support: While egg whites primarily provide protein, they also contain small amounts of vitamins and minerals that may benefit overall skin health.
